Requirements
  • A b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Mathematics, Accounting, a technical certification, or an equivalent combination of education and relevant experience.
  • Strong hands-on automated testing skills, including building and maintaining test cases with tools such as Selenium.
  • Technical proficiency in Java or .NET, relational databases, and API or web-service testing.
  • Experience implementing test scripts within a CI/CD pipeline and using test management tools such as qTest or Jira.
  • Ability to solve ambiguous quality problems with limited guidance rather than requiring a fully defined test plan.
  • Ability and willingness to learn modern tools such as Playwright, K6, and data simulation, along with emerging tools such as MCPs or testing agents.
  • Sufficient finance and accounting domain interest to develop deep expertise in the PowerPlan product.
Responsibilities
  • Learn the current test environments and release process and progress toward independent release sign-off for at least part of the product by the end of the first quarter.
  • Expand the automation framework with new functions and reusable components by building automated test cases in tools such as Selenium, and deliver at least one new function or component within the first quarter.
  • Develop Playwright and K6 usage, build data simulation for test data, and evaluate how MCPs or testing agents could further advance the framework.
  • Create a repeatable readiness check for test-data, environment, and configuration needs, and identify and drive resolution of cross-team roadblocks before they threaten a release.
  • Build and maintain automated tests across the full stack, including Java or .NET, databases, and API or web-service layers.
  • Develop knowledge of PowerPlan's asset accounting and tax domain so testing identifies business-logic problems as well as technical defects.

PowerPlan provides software for asset-intensive businesses to manage and optimize their capital and asset lifecycle. Its tools collect and organize asset data to support budgeting, forecasting, scenario analysis, and regulatory compliance. Revenue comes from licenses or subscriptions and professional services, with added value from the Social Power professional community. Its goal is to expand its footprint in the U.S. and Canada by helping more organizations improve financial decisions, asset performance, and compliance.

PowerPlan launches NXT platform for firms managing over $4T in assets

PowerPlan has announced the general availability of PowerPlan NXT, a next-generation tax and accounting platform for asset-intensive industries. The software, enhanced with AI-powered capabilities and built on SaaS architecture, unifies the entire asset lifecycle from capital planning to regulatory compliance on a single platform. The company's customers collectively manage over $4 trillion in property, plant and equipment across more than 200 organisations in utilities, oil and gas, telecommunications and transportation. PowerPlan maintains a 99% customer retention rate. Key features include AI-driven workflow accelerators, natural language insights, enterprise-grade security and continuous quarterly updates. The platform is designed to reduce close cycles, improve data quality and align finance, tax and regulatory teams whilst eliminating data silos between point solutions.
